Culinary PicturesCooking Up a Culinary Arts Career

For people who can take the heat, a culinary arts career is the best way to stay in the kitchen. Of all the careers, culinary offers one of the most exciting environments, the non-traditional work available. Those who have a passion for food preparation can be found sharing their gifts in the smallest cafes to the best of world-class restaurants.

For most people, eating is a very common phenomenon. It's a chance to get out and socialize while being served a gourmet meal in a beautiful setting. Few stop to think that the meal together before them is the result of a higher education in the science of cooking.

When you make a career of cooking and dining, many find there is more to the image of that of just making delicious food. The culinary arts and his unconventional work environment provides many specific tasks that are not usually found in desktop environment to the average. Not only is there the accounting and inventory of groceries, there are issues of combustion safety knife thinking.

However, the career of culinary arts is becoming increasingly popular as the restaurant industry is growing rapidly. From hospitals to high-end resorts, the appeal of a restaurant, institutional and even short-order cooks is loud and clear. While working in a kitchen requires flawless professionalism, it is also a place where we can be really creative at the same time.

With the number of specializations that go to a culinary career, many people take great pleasure in being able to refine their profession to their own preferences. For example, some may choose to become a restaurant chef, they can still choose to become a restaurant chef who specializes in Japanese cuisine. Others become and my pastry chefs who focus on macrobiotic dishes.

Get training in Culinary Arts is particularly important for those who own their own restaurants. Learning to run an efficient kitchen is a must if a company restaurant is to be not only efficient but also profitable. Also be aware competently manage employees while providing a safe work environment and ethics. These concepts are taught in regular classes.

Another occupation on the rise in the culinary arts is a personal chef. What was a bit unknown a decade ago, the position is becoming one of the careers most in demand. Committed to make delicious meals leaders concerned about their personal health can be richly rewarded with both job satisfaction and purchasing power.

Food safety and equipment to get a culinary degree absolutely necessary for those who want to work in a kitchen. While there may be some entry-level positions in institutions, they are few and do not provide any type of culinary freedom. The rights are often limited to clean.

Become a leader or chef in a restaurant requires extensive training. However, many graduates choose to work culinary entry-level positions and combine their training with their experience and work upwards. The chance to be head of a renowned restaurant is the dream of a lifetime for many food lovers.

When training for a career in culinary arts, the students will be putting their knowledge to use in a practical environment. By choosing an accredited program, financial assistance is often available to help reduce the financial burden of obtaining a good education. This can help make things happen and put students right in the kitchen just as they have always wanted to be.
